We are seeking an Applied Machine Learning Research Scientist to join our Accessibility efforts on the Human-Centered Machine Intelligence (HCMI) team within AIML at Apple. Research Scientists in HCMI tackle significant technical challenges, collaborate with partner teams to ship products, and shape the field of human-centered AIML via external publication. Join us to advance ML research and intelligent interactive technologies that enable people of all abilities to use Apple technology.
Description
The Human-Centered Machine Intelligence (HCMI) group advances ML modeling and interactive technologies grounded in human-centered research. We are a close-knit team of research scientists and engineers working closely with product and platform teams across Apple.
The Accessibility team within HCMI specifically focuses on core ML technologies that address grand challenges in accessibility, including equitable speech access for people with communication disabilities, visual understanding for people who are blind or low vision, sign language technology, and more. We are especially interested in researchers who want to bring expertise in one or more of the following areas to these accessibility challenges: multimodal reasoning, agentic systems and multi-turn interaction, contextual understanding, privacy-preserving ML, and synthetic data and evaluation methodologies.

Senior Level Applied Scientist Jobs: Frequently Asked Questions
How do I get a senior level applied scientist job?
Employers hiring at this level look for candidates who have moved beyond executing research to shaping it. That means a portfolio of end-to-end projects where you owned the problem definition, methodology, and production deployment. Strong candidates demonstrate cross-functional influence, a record of mentoring junior scientists, and depth in a domain like NLP, computer vision, reinforcement learning, or causal inference that aligns with the team's roadmap.

What makes an applied scientist role senior level?
Senior applied scientist roles are defined by ownership and scope rather than task execution. Responsibilities include setting the technical direction for a research area, making architectural decisions that affect multiple systems or products, and mentoring earlier-career scientists. Candidates are expected to drive projects from ambiguous problem statements through to deployed, measurable outcomes with limited day-to-day guidance from above.
